Purpose of the position:

The purpose of this position is to ensure all eligible individuals receive timely public assistance benefits by determining or re-determining eligibility of Buncombe County residents applying for public assistance across multiple Income Maintenance programs.

Minimum Education Training and/or Experience (required at time of hire): Associates degree in Human Services Technology Social Services Paralegal Technology Business Administration Secretarial Science or a closely related curriculum and two (2) years of paraprofessional clerical or other public contact experience which included negotiating interviewing explaining information gathering and compiling of data analysis of data and/or performance of mathematical legal tasks or determining eligibility (or one (1) year of Income Maintenance experience); or graduation from high school and three (3) years of paraprofessional clerical or other public contact experience which included negotiating interviewing explaining information gathering and compiling of data analysis of data and/or performance of mathematical legal tasks or determining eligibility; or an equivalent combination of training and experience.

Additional Training and Experience: English/Spanish bilingual speakers preferred

Essential Functions of the position:

  • Determine client eligibility for benefits accurately and within local community Federal and State mandated time frames.
  • Gather and interpret client data obtained through interview process case file review and/or third-party verification.
  • Provide information to clients/applicants regarding programs services and eligibility requirements and outcomes.
  • Organize and maintain ongoing caseloads to maintain timeliness and quality assurance per Federal and State guidelines along with Buncombe County best practices.
  • Identify cases for investigation of potential fraud and submit appropriate fraud referral documentation.
  • Perform other related duties as assigned.

Knowledge Skills Abilities:

  • Current knowledge of available agency community Federal and State programs along with eligibility criteria timelines and requirements.
  • Ability to analyze comprehend and apply rules and regulations and often changing policies and guidelines pertaining to eligibility requirements for programs.
  • Ability to be flexible and adapt to change.
  • Ability to accept work direction from multiple parties and work as part of a team.
  • Ability to work with and interpret facts and figures and perform tasks involving a high degree of accuracy learn the intricacies of numerous forms and procedures of public assistance programs.
  • Proficiency working with a variety of computer systems and software.
  • Report and react to changes in programs to clients and update eligibility or program requirements as needed.
  • Report potentially fraudulent claims or information to Program Integrity.
  • Maintain clear and accurate records review caseload information on a minimum of an annual basis.
  • Assist in local and state hearing processes as necessary.
  • Knowledge of policies procedures regulations and rules regarding programs to provide accurate and timely information to ongoing and potential clients.
  • Skill in data entry into a computer and operating general office equipment.
  • Ability to maintain effective working relationships with the assigned caseload and general public.
